Technical Coordinator

Job LocationSawston
EducationNot Mentioned
Salary£50,000 - £55,000 per annum
IndustryNot Mentioned
Functional AreaNot Mentioned
Job TypePermanent, full-time

Job Description

This is a new and excellent opportunity to join a respected company within their award-winning teamYou will be joining an award-winning company working within their technical team in their Cambridge office. They are an established company going from strength to strength and are continuing to grow their team.You will be working primarily within the residential sector on both private sector and affordable housing schemes. Duties to include:

  • Responsible for managing individual projects throughout the Working Drawings stage (alongside external development partners where required) ensuring that these are produced to the agreed design and specification standards, achieve agreed programmes.
  • Responsible for managing the in-house Working Drawings programme and for inputting into design team master programme
  • Preparation of Employers Requirements and Specifications to meet sales and development aspirations
  • Assist in the preparation of Standard Specifications, and library of Standard Design and Construction Details
  • Provide Technical Design audits on planning schemes (prepared both in-house and externally) to ensure that agreed design standards are met and that development potential is maximised.
  • Responsible for ensuring that working drawings comply with the design intent of the agreed Contract Drawings and meet the requirements of the Development Team, Sales Team and the Architectural Design Team
  • Providing individual design detailing support on projects during the working drawings and construction process, including attending site to carry out inspections as and when required.
  • Manage and support junior members of the team
  • Liaise and negotiate with Local Authorities and Regulatory Bodies to maximise development potential of individual schemes
  • Experience:
  • Architectural qualification required, either registered architect or architectural technologist, and 10 years’ experience in the residential architecture sector.
  • A good knowledge of building processes and Building Regulations
  • Experience of running individual projects and co-ordinating consultants through working drawing stages of a project.
  • Revit and AutoCAD proficiency
  • Salary circa £50,000 - £55,000 per annum + company car / car allowance Required skills
